Computer, Keyboard, and Display

CAUTION:
Before you clean your computer, disconnect the computer from the
electrical outlet and remove any installed batteries. Clean your computer with a
soft cloth dampened with water. Do not use liquid or aerosol cleaners, which may
contain flammable substances.
Use a can of compressed air to remove dust from between the keys on the
keyboard.
NOTICE:
To avoid damaging the computer or display, do not spray cleaning solution
directly onto the display. Only use products specifically designed for cleaning
displays, and follow the instructions that are included with the product.
Moisten a soft, lint-free cloth with either water or a display cleaner, and
wipe the display until it is clean.
Moisten a soft, lint-free cloth with water and wipe the computer and
keyboard. Do not allow water from the cloth to seep between the touch
pad and the surrounding palm rest.

Touch Pad

1 Shut down and turn off your computer (see "Turning Off Your Computer"
on page 37).
2 Disconnect any attached devices from the computer and from their
electrical outlets.
3 Remove any installed batteries (see the Service Manual for your system on
support.dell.com).
4 Moisten a soft, lint-free cloth with water, and wipe it gently across the
surface of the touch pad. Do not allow water from the cloth to seep
between the touch pad and the surrounding palm rest.
